But to see the buy button you need to meet a few requirements (mine did not say buy untill all were met btw) You must have the iPod Touch connected to your computer, it must be 1.1.3 already, and you must have iTunes 7.6 installed. I had all but iTunes 7.6, and it says all of this info on the page where you try to buy it. All the people probably trying to get the apps still probably have 7.5 because they want the option to downgrade to 1.1.1 if they do not like it I'm guessing (apple fixed the downgrade option in 7.6).
